Sarah O’Rourke
Teacher of English Language and Literature
Taughtly is a company run by Sarah O’Rourke, an English teacher, tutor, resource creator and examiner.
Sarah is an experienced teacher of English Language and Literature with Qualified Teacher Status (QTS) in the UK. She began teaching in 2015 in the UK state system, working in an Ofsted Outstanding school as part of the Teach First Leadership Programme.
After this, Sarah moved into international education, working within the Dulwich family of schools in China. First, she worked at Dulwich International High School Suzhou, where she led the First Language English IGCSE course, alongside teaching EAL, IELTS, literature and academic writing. Whilst she was working at DHSZ, Sarah completed her Master’s Degree in Education with the University of Manchester.
In 2021, Sarah transferred to Dulwich College Beijing, where she worked as the Assistant Head of English. She taught First Language English IGCSE, English Literature IGCSE, Key Stage 3 English, and IB English A. She is certified to teach the IB, having undertaken both the Category 1 and Category 2 training courses. During this time, she has worked as an examiner for various IGCSE and A Level English exams.
Sarah began making educational resources under the name of Wow English, then rebranded to Taughtly in 2023. She currently works as a tutor and educational resource creator, making Youtube video lessons, courses, and teaching resources on Taughtly.
Sarah O’Rourke’s curriculum experience
Courses Sarah has taught:
- IB English A – Language and Literature
- AS English General – Cambridge
- IGCSE First Language English – Cambridge
- IGCSE English as a Second Language – Cambridge
- IGCSE World Literature – Cambridge
- IGCSE English Literature – Edexcel
- GCSE English Language – AQA
- GCSE English Literature – OCR
- KS3 English Language and Literature
Sarah O’Rourke’s qualifications and career history
- Undergraduate Degree in English Language and Literature
- Fully-qualified teacher, gaining a PGCE teaching certificate in the UK and holding Qualified Teacher Status (QTS)
- Master’s Degree in Education, specialising in international education and test anxiety
- Taught English Language and Literature in a UK state school for ages 11-16
- Taught English Language, Literature and EAL in China for ages 14-18
- Taught English Language and Literature for IGCSE and IB students in China, students aged 11-18
- Examines IGCSE and A Level English exams